#afe04d - RGB(175, 224, 77) - Conifer Color FAQ

What is the color code for Conifer?

Hex color code for Conifer color is #afe04d. RGB color code for conifer color is rgb(175, 224, 77).

What is the RGB value of #afe04d?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#afe04d is rgb(175, 224, 77).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'175' indicates the intensity of the red component, '224' represents the green component's intensity, and '77'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#afe04d.

What does RGB 175,224,77 mean?

The RGB color 175, 224, 77 represents a bright and vivid shade of Green. The websafe version of this color is hex 99cc66.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to Conifer.

What is the C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) color model of #afe04d?

In the C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#afe04d is composed of 22% Cyan, 0% Magenta, 66% Yellow, and 12% Black.
